  • Lack of saving

Another factor causing failures in entertainment businesses is the lack of savings. There are times when the business will earn abnormal profits. But also, there are moments of reduced sales. Regardless of the situation, it would be best if you were quick to save some little cash. The survival of the firm will also depend on the available float. Do you have enough money to increase your stock or to pay for the new employees?

It would help if you tried as much as possible to start a business without a loan. If you have loans, you’ll need to repay them as agreed. Now, what if the venture is not making profits and you don’t have another income source?

  • Inadequate marketing research and strategies

How do you market your services? Digital marketing is gaining popularity among many entrepreneurs. You must be ahead with the relevant marketing strategy that will boost sales in your business.

Through research, you can evaluate how other businesses are managing. Be quick to know their strengths and their weaknesses. Additionally, you should check what your clients want. Finally, ensure that you interact with them through one on one calls or messaging. After collecting such info, you’ll be certain of the best marketing strategy to adopt for the business.
